I cant tell if its too big because im lookin at it from an ipod, but i like the background and effects but text is ugly.

 

Try duplicating the font and putting it behind real text. Then make the back text black and gaussian blur it. It creates like a drop shadow behind text and makes it look a little better.

What do you mean? What is a "regular" drop shadow?

 

I'm assuming you use Photoshop?

 

Layer > Layer Style > Effects > Drop Shadow

 

You just select color, opacity, distance, and spread and stuff.

I'll try that and does anybody know how to make the font slanted in Photoshop? Was trying to figure it out but I couldn't. Thought that angling the letters toward Adrian would make it look nicer text.

to slant your font:

put your text in and rasterize it. (just click ERASE anywhere on the text layer where theres no text and you'll get the option to do this.) click ok

now click edit/transform and then Perspective.

just play around with it till you get what you are looking for.
